    Supervised or monitored visitation occurs when one parent loses custody or visitation rights to a child(ren). For that parent to see their child(ren), the courts have mandated that a supervisor or monitoring person be present during all interactions with the child(ren). **This position is ideal for CWYs looking for summer employment. This role reports to the Clinical Service Manager of Children's Mental Health.

Accountabilities:

- Conduct assessments
- Conduct groups and provide case management services for children and youth with complex needs

**Qualifications**
- Child and youth work diploma
- Current member of Ontario Association of Child and Youth Counsellors
- Undergraduate Degree in Psychology would be an asset
- Two to three years current experience in child and adolescent mental health, conducting behavioral assessments with children, adolescents, and families, and responding to challenging behavior in a hospital/group home/classroom setting
- Demonstrated ability to work in collaboration with other team members to develop and implement individualized treatment approaches for patients and families in the context of a milieu setting, using evidence based approaches
- Knowledge of the major disorders of childhood
- Demonstrated ability to assist in modeling effective behavior management strategies
- Experience in collaborating with teachers
- Experience in developing and conducting therapeutic groups
- Experience in providing case management services
- Must be willing to work in secure, open, and day hospital settings
- Must demonstrate Osler's Values of Respect, Excellence, Service, Compassion, Innovation and Collaboration
- Excellent organizational, interpersonal and communication skills
- Computer proficiency
- Excellent attendance, punctuality and work record
